Acquiring Relevant Education and Skills
Depending on your chosen role, certain educational backgrounds or skills may be required. For example, aspiring dealers might benefit from attending a dealer school to learn the rules and techniques of games like blackjack or poker. Those interested in management or marketing roles may find a degree in business or hospitality advantageous. Additionally, developing strong customer service skills, along with proficiency in mathematics and attention to detail, can be beneficial across many casino positions.
Gaining Experience in the Hospitality Sector
Experience in the hospitality or service industry can be a significant asset when applying for casino jobs. Many skills are transferable, such as customer service, handling transactions, and managing guest interactions. Working in hotels, restaurants, or other service-oriented businesses can provide a solid foundation and make you a more competitive candidate for casino roles.

Starting in Entry-Level Positions
For those new to the industry, starting in an entry-level position is an excellent way to gain experience and learn the inner workings of a casino. Roles such as casino host, dealer, or slot attendant provide hands-on experience and a deeper understanding of casino operations. These positions often serve as stepping stones to more advanced roles within the industry, offering opportunities for growth and advancement.
